P05 · Implementation blueprint · Mappls Public Safety Command
Video, sensors, incidents and field units are fragmented, so operators lack a common operational picture and response accountability.
01 · Target operating outcome
Can your command centre answer—on one map—what happened, what is nearby, who is responding and whether the SLA was met?
Business case: lower incident-to-dispatch/arrival time, higher asset uptime, faster investigation and auditable SLA compliance.
Measure current volume, time, cost, failure, service, risk and revenue at the workflow level.
Feed integration stable; location accuracy accepted; operator steps/time reduced; audit trail and security review passed.
02 · Solution architecture
GIS operational picture integrating CCTV/sensors, incidents, patrol assets, jurisdictions, SOP workflows, analytics and evidence-linked dashboards. We make the map the operational control layer linking incidents, sensors, jurisdiction, resources and response—not simply a basemap beneath CCTV.

The shared Mappls identity is separated from application membership. A user can be an administrator in one app, an analyst in another and a viewer elsewhere.
04 · Data and integration
Map, road, address, place, imagery, boundary and terrain layers appropriate to the decision.
Customer, order, asset, vehicle, incident, task, sensor or transaction records from systems of record.
APIs, SDKs, secure batch, streaming events, webhooks, files or on-premise integration depending on architecture.
Least-privilege RBAC, audit events, encrypted transport, tenant separation and cloud, private or offline deployment.

Product details05 · Proof of value
6–8 week pilot integrating selected cameras/sensors, incident feed, jurisdiction and dispatch workflow.
